Question 265544: The formula s = 16t2 is used to approximate the distance s, in feet, that an object falls freely (from rest) in t seconds. Use this formula to solve the problem.
How long would it take an object to fall freely from a bridge 725 feet above the water?
Answer by Alan3354(69443) (Show Source): You can put this solution on YOUR website!
725 = 16t^2
t^2 = 725/16
solve for t
